I had the same problem with fans even though they were in the next room they were keeping me awake, invested in an Airforce II, not cheap but very quiet and powerful this pulls air through a Rhino Pro filter and pushes through a double lamp cool tube using acoustic ducting hung using 10mm elastic bungee cord, for the second fan which is mounted on the floor I made a box out of MDF glued an inch thick polystyrene slab to the bottom and lined the box with 1/2ins acoustic plasterboard and acoustic foam on top of that, asked at the local builders suppliers if they had any damaged plasterboard got it for the price of a drink and got the acoustic foam off e bay for about £8 worked a treat, good luck with your problem.

car sound deadening material on your fans may do the trick. you want mass loaded vinyl.
http://www.raamaudio.com/raammat-bxt-ii-bulk-pack-20-sheets-37-5-sq-ft-real-automotive-sound-deadener-best-there-is-for-the-money-period-please-click-to-see-product-description/
stick it to all your fan bodies and duct work. or, if you want a cheaper route, try duct insulation from lowes. its an adhesive foam with a foil backing. use it just like the other stuff i mentioned.
